Nigeria’s central bank is rewriting the rules for fintech growth

Over the past decade, the playbook for Nigerian fintechs has been remarkably consistent: build payment products, acquire merchants, scale transaction volumes, obtain microfinance bank licences, expand into lending, and eventually launch savings products.
